0.43 g of O-(7-azabenzotriazol-1-yl)-N,N,N′,N′-tetramethyluronium hexafluorophosphine (1.12 mmol) was added to 0.49 g of 3-chloro-6′-(6-morpholin-4-yl-1H-benzoimidazol-2-yl)-[2,3]bipyridinyl-5-carboxylic acid (79) (1.12 mmol) prepared in Example 66 dissolved in 1.0 mL of tetrahydrofuran and 1.0 mL of dimethylformamide, and stirred at room temperature for 10 minutes. 0.56 mL of ethylamine (1.12 mmol) in 2.0 M tetrahydrofuran solution was added thereto, and refluxed under heating and stirring for 18 hours. The mixture was cooled to room temperature, and concentrated under reduced pressure. Then, the mixture was dissolved in ethyl acetate, and washed with water. The organic layer was dried over magnesium sulfate, and concentrated under reduced pressure. The residue was separated by column chromatography (eluting solvent: chloroform/methanol=20/1) to obtain 0.35 g of 3-chloro-6′-(6-morpholin-4-yl-1H-benzoimidazol-2-yl)-[2,3]bipyridinyl-5-carboxylic acid ethyl amide (yield 68%).
